/*
Theme Name: SK Spacious
Theme URI: http://www.steffenkahl.de/2015-12/wordpress-4-4-de-edition-installiert/#yoko
Author: Steffen Kahl
Author URI: http://www.steffenkahl.de/
Description: Meine Anpassung an "Spacious".
Version: 1.1
License: GNU General Public License v2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Tags: responsive, two-columns, right-sidebar, left-sidebar, flexible-width, custom-header, custom-menu
Text Domain: sk-spacious
Template: spacious
*/
@import url("../spacious/style.css");

body {background-color:#efe4c4}

#content .related {margin:0 30px 0 30px; font-size:smaller}
#content .related-no {font-style:italic; margin:0 30px 0 30px; font-size:smaller}

/* Flickr Album Maker */
.Album {width:625px; background:#f5f5f5; padding:5px}
.AlbumPhoto {background:#f5f5f5; margin-bottom:10px}
.AlbumPhoto span {float:left; padding:4px 4px 12px 4px; border:1px solid #ddd; background:#fff; margin:8px}
.AlbumPhoto img {border:none; margin:0 0 0 0}

/* Für gebloggte Fotos von flickr.com */
#content .flickr-photo {border:solid 1px #444444; margin:0 0 0 0}
.flickr-yourcomment { }
.flickr-frame {text-align:left; padding:3px}
#content .flickr-caption {font-size:smaller; margin:0 0 15px 0}

#content .flickrleft {border:solid 1px #444444; margin:5px 10px 0 0; float:left}
#content .flickrright {border:solid 1px #444444; margin:5px 0 0 10px; float:right}

.fotos {font-size:80%; background:#efe4c4; padding-right:5px; padding-left:5px}
.fotobg {margin-top:35px}
.fotobgr {margin-top:35px; margin-left:50px}
#content .bildschatten {background: url(images/bildschatten.png) no-repeat bottom left; padding: 4px 7px 17px 7px; border-top: 2px solid #efefef}

.date {font-size:80%; margin:0 15px 0 15px}
#content .photoblock {float:left; width:100px; margin-bottom:10px}
#content .photoblock-th {float:left; width:125px; margin-bottom:10px}
#content .photoblock-kl {float:left; width:265px; margin-bottom:10px}
.square {border:1px solid #ccc}

#content .thumbnail {border:1px solid #ccc; margin-right: 10px; float:left}

#content .small {color:#808080; font-size:80%}
#content .hoch {vertical-align:+4px; font-size:80%;}
#content .tief {vertical-align:-4px; font-size:80%;}

.important{background:#f0f0f0 url(images/link-icon_important.png) no-repeat 0.5em center;border-top:1px solid #ddd; border-bottom:1px solid #ddd; margin-top:1px; margin-bottom:10px; padding:0.2em 30px 0.2em 35px;}
a.delicious {text-align:right; padding-right:12px; background:url(images/link-icon_delicious.gif) no-repeat right;}
/* Inspiriert vom Link Indication plugin */
a.extern {padding-right:12px; background:url(images/link-icon_extern.gif) no-repeat right;}
a.amazon {padding-right:20px; background:url(images/link-icon_amazon.png) no-repeat right;}
a.sk {padding-right:12px; background:url(images/link-icon_intern.png) no-repeat right;}
a.wikipedia {padding-right:15px; background:url(images/link-icon_wikipedia.gif) no-repeat right;}
a.piwigo {padding-right:17px; background:url(images/link-icon_piwigo.png) no-repeat right;}
a.flickr {padding-right:9px; background:url(images/link-icon_flickr.png) no-repeat right;}
a.pdf {padding-right:13px; background:url(images/link-icon_pdf.png) no-repeat right;}
a.wp {padding-right:15px; background:url(images/link-icon_wordpress.png) no-repeat right;}
a.twitter {padding-right:18px; background:url(images/twitter.png) no-repeat right;}
#content a.rss {padding-left:22px; background: url(images/feed.gif) no-repeat 0 center;}

blockquote {text-align:center;color:#999;letter-spacing:0;font-size:125%}

.toc {text-align:right; font-variant:small-caps; background-color:#efe4c4;
    border:1px solid #444444;
    -moz-border-radius: 9px;
    -webkit-border-radius: 9px;    
      border-radius: 9px;
    margin:25px 50px 0 50px; padding:5px 20px;
}
.beitrag {border:2px solid #efe4c4; margin:5px 30px 10px 30px; padding:10px 25px 0 25px;}
.lied {border:2px solid #efe4c4; margin:5px 30px 0 30px; padding:5px 10px; text-align:center;
    -moz-border-radius: 15px;
    -webkit-border-radius: 15px;    
      border-radius: 15px;
}
.verweis {margin:15px 50px 15px 50px;}
.link {background-color:#f0f0f0;
    border:1px solid #444444;
    -moz-border-radius: 15px; /* Mozilla */
    -webkit-border-radius: 15px; /* Webkit */    
      border-radius: 15px;
    -moz-box-shadow: 5px 5px 15px #444444;
    -webkit-box-shadow: 5px 5px 15px #444444;
      box-shadow: 15px;
    margin:25px 50px 15px 50px; padding:20px 25px 1px 25px;
}
.link h4 {color:#444444}

ul#menu-standard {text-transform: uppercase;}
#content a:hover {text-decoration-line:underline; text-decoration-color:#777777; text-decoration-style:solid;}

.new {font:8px Verdana,Arial,Helvetica,sans-serif;color:#000;background:#FFE28A;padding:1px;vertical-align:middle;}
.gedenken {font-weight:bold; color:#000; background:#efe4c4; border-width:1px; border-color:black; padding:25px;}

.reference {font-style:italic; color:#777777; font-weight:bold; text-align:right; font-size:smaller; margin:0 50px 20px 0} 
#content .page .ref-air {text-align:center;
    float:right;
    font-variant:small-caps;
    font-size:80%;
    background-color:#efe4c4;
    border:1px solid #444444;
    -moz-border-radius: 9px;
    -webkit-border-radius: 9px;
      border-radius: 9px;
    max-width:175px;    
    padding:5px 20px 5px 20px;
}
#content th {text-align:left; background-color:#efe4c4;}
tr:nth-child(odd) {background-color: #eeeeee;}
tr:nth-child(even) {background-color: #fff;}

.ayb404 {font: italic 325%/0.2em Georgia, sans-serif; color: #ddd;}

.wp-caption {
border: 1px solid #ddd;
text-align: center;
background-color: #f0f0f0;
padding-top: 9px;
margin: 10px;
-moz-border-radius: 3px;
-khtml-border-radius: 3px;
-webkit-border-radius: 3px;
border-radius: 3px;
}
#content .wp-caption p.wp-caption-text {
font-size: smaller;
line-height: 17px;
padding: 0 4px 5px;
margin: 0;
}

.spalten2 {
	  -moz-column-count: 2;
	  -moz-column-gap: 10px;
	  -moz-column-rule: none;
	  -webkit-column-count: 2;
	  -webkit-column-gap: 10px;
	  -webkit-column-rule: none;
	column-count: 2;
	column-gap: 10px;
	column-rule: none;
}

.spalten3 {
	  -moz-column-count: 3;
	  -moz-column-gap: 10px;
	  -moz-column-rule: none;
	  -webkit-column-count: 3;
	  -webkit-column-gap: 10px;
	  -webkit-column-rule: none;
	column-count: 3;
	column-gap: 10px;
	column-rule: none;
}
/* --- Sidebar --- */
#secondary .widget {margin-bottom: 20px;}
